Bash urlencode and urldecode
urlencode() {
# urlencode <string>
old_lc_collate=$LC_COLLATE
LC_COLLATE=C
local length="${#1}"
for (( i = 0; i < length; i++ )); do
local c="${1:$i:1}"
case $c in
[a-zA-Z0-9.~_-]) printf '%s' "$c" ;;
*) printf '%%%02X' "'$c" ;;
esac
done
LC_COLLATE=$old_lc_collate
}
urldecode() {
# urldecode <string>
local url_encoded="${1//+/ }"
printf '%b' "${url_encoded//%/\\x}"
}

@rajeshisnepali for urldecode to work with my zsh:
In zsh ${url_encoded//%/\\x} adds a \x to the end but ${url_encoded//\%/\\x} replaces % with \x.
lri - https://unix.stackexchange.com/questions/159253/decoding-url-encoding-percent-encoding

also, in urlencode, $i could be made local
local i length="${#1}"

LC_ALL=C is needed to support unicode = loop bytes, not characters.
LC_COLLATE=C or LANG=C do not work.
this also must be set before ${#1} to get the length of $1 in bytes

#!/usr/bin/env bash
# MIT License

# encode special characters per RFC 3986
urlencode() {
    local LC_ALL=C # support unicode = loop bytes, not characters
    local c i n=${#1}
    for (( i=0; i<n; i++ )); do
        c="${1:i:1}"
        case "$c" in
            [-_.~A-Za-z0-9]) # also encode ;,/?:@&=+$!*'()# == encodeURIComponent in javascript
            #[-_.~A-Za-z0-9\;,/?:@\&=+\$!*\'\(\)#]) # dont encode ;,/?:@&=+$!*'()# == encodeURI in javascript
               printf '%s' "$c" ;;
            *) printf '%%%02X' "'$c" ;;
        esac
    done
    echo
}

_test_urlencode() {
  local fname=urlencode
  local auml=$'\xC3\xA4' # ä = %C3%A4
  local euro=$'\xE2\x82\xAC' # € = %E2%82%AC
  local tick=$'\x60' # ` = %60
  local backtick=$'\xC2\xB4' # ´ = %C2%B4
  local input="a:/b c?d=e&f#g-+-;-,-@-\$-!-*-'-(-)-#-$tick-$backtick-$auml-$euro"
  # note: we expect uppercase hex codes from %02X format string
  local expected="a%3A%2Fb%20c%3Fd%3De%26f%23g-%2B-%3B-%2C-%40-%24-%21-%2A-%27-%28-%29-%23-%60-%C2%B4-%C3%A4-%E2%82%AC" # also encode ;,/?:@&=+$!*'()#
  #local expected="a:/b%20c?d=e&f#g-+-;-,-@-\$-!-*-'-(-)-#-%60-%C2%B4-%C3%A4-%E2%82%AC" # dont encode ;,/?:@&=+$!*'()#
  local actual="$($fname "$input")"
  if [[ "$actual" != "$expected" ]]; then
    echo "error in $fname"
    # debug
    echo "input: $input"
    echo "input hex:"; echo -n "$input" | hexdump -v -e '/1 "%02X"' | sed 's/\(..\)/\\x\1/g'; echo
    echo "input hexdump:"; echo -n "$input" | hexdump -C
    printf "actual:   "; echo "$actual"
    printf "expected: "; echo "$expected"
    exit 1
  fi
}
_test_urlencode

@ThePredators this breaks on unicode

input: a:/b c?d=e&f#g-+-`-´-ä-€
input hex:
\x61\x3A\x2F\x62\x20\x63\x3F\x64\x3D\x65\x26\x66\x23\x67\x2D\x2B\x2D\x60\x2D\xC2\xB4\x2D\xC3\xA4\x2D\xE2\x82\xAC
input hexdump:
00000000  61 3a 2f 62 20 63 3f 64  3d 65 26 66 23 67 2d 2b  |a:/b c?d=e&f#g-+|
00000010  2d 60 2d c2 b4 2d c3 a4  2d e2 82 ac              |-`-..-..-...|
0000001c
actual:   a%3A%2Fb%20c%3Fd%3De%26f%23g-%2B-%60-%B4-%E4-%20AC
expected: a%3A%2Fb%20c%3Fd%3De%26f%23g-%2B-%60-%C2%B4-%C3%A4-%E2%82%AC
